Search

Search Constraints

Start Over You searched for: Language Spanish Remove constraint Language: Spanish Category Religion Remove constraint Category: Religion Subject Protestant churches Remove constraint Subject: Protestant churches Subject Science and technology Remove constraint Subject: Science and technology

Search Results